Expect moderate discomfort primarily during shading phases. The outer forearm and thigh feature thicker skin with fewer nerve endings, keeping pain manageable. Sensation resembles a hot scratch rather than sharp stabbing. Black-grey packing requires the needle to stay in one area longer, increasing sensitivity. Practice controlled breathing to manage tension. Hydrate well before your appointment and eat a substantial meal. Request short breaks every forty-five minutes if needed. Overall, this placement ranks comfortably within the tolerable range for most collectors.
This square-format design adapts well to flat surfaces with moderate curvature. The outer forearm offers excellent visibility and canvas space, allowing the volcanic textures to breathe without distortion during arm movement. For a more private placement, the outer thigh provides ample room for scaling the design larger, enhancing the intricate shading details. Shoulder placements work effectively if the design is oriented to follow the deltoid curve. Minimum sizing should be around four inches to prevent the black-grey shading from blurring together over time. Avoid highly mobile joints like the elbow or wrist where the square shape may warp. Professional attire considerations favor the thigh or upper arm for easy concealment. Ensure your artist maps the design to the muscle grain for optimal healing and longevity.

Illustrative: Illustrative tattoos capture the aesthetic of hand-drawn illustrations, book artwork, and graphic novels. These designs emphasize artistic linework, cross-hatching, and stylized imagery that appears to have been drawn directly onto the skin. Botanical: Botanical tattoos feature detailed depictions of flowers, plants, leaves, and natural elements inspired by scientific botanical illustrations.
